A study to assess the postoperative pain score after pudendal nerve block in patients undergoing laparoscopic abdominoperineal excision surgery for anorectal carcinoma.

Eligibility

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: undergoing elective laparoscopic abdominoperineal excision surgeries

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Patient refusal 1.Patients with allergic history for local anesthetic drug 2. Patients with coagulopathies 3. Patients with active infection at injection site 4.Emergency surgeries 5. Conversion to open laparotomy

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Assessment of postoperative pain intensity at intervals of 6, 12, 24 and 48 hours using Visual Analog Scale (VAS: 0 10) at rest and on movement.Timepoint: Assessment of postoperative pain intensity at intervals of 6, 12, 24 and 48 hours using Visual Analog Scale (VAS: 0 10) at rest and on movement.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
1.Time for rescue analgesia. 2.Perineal pain score. 3.Number & timing of additional analgesic doses/interventions within the first 48h 4.Duration of effective block in hours.Timepoint: 6,12,24 & 48 hours.
